Concrete pathway repair services focus on restoring and maintaining the safety, functionality, and appearance of existing walkways, sidewalks, and pathways around residential properties. These projects often involve fixing cracks, uneven surfaces, or damaged sections caused by weather, ground shifting, or regular wear and tear. Homeowners typically seek this service to prevent tripping hazards, improve curb appeal, or prepare for future landscaping and outdoor improvements. Understanding the extent of damage, the type of concrete, and the desired outcome can help property owners make informed decisions before requesting repairs.
The scope of concrete pathway repair can include patching small cracks, leveling uneven surfaces, removing and replacing sections of damaged concrete, and applying sealants to protect against future deterioration. Property owners should consider factors such as the age of the existing concrete, the severity of damage, and the overall style of their outdoor space when planning repairs. Clear communication about these details can ensure the repair work addresses specific concerns and helps maintain the pathway’s safety and appearance over time.

Concrete Pathway Repair Questions
What types of damage can occur to a concrete pathway? Common issues include cracking, spalling, uneven surfaces, and surface deterioration caused by weather and age.
How are concrete pathways repaired? Repairs typically involve patching cracks, leveling uneven sections, and restoring surface integrity to improve safety and appearance.
When should a concrete pathway be repaired? Repairs are needed when cracks, holes, or uneven areas become noticeable or pose a safety concern for pedestrians.
What are common causes of pathway damage? Damage often results from ground movement, freeze-thaw cycles, heavy loads, or improper initial installation.
